Oracle DBA实战:深度解析性能优化与内部机制

5星 · 超过95%的资源 需积分: 10 285 下载量 176 浏览量 更新于2024-07-28 10 收藏 50.47MB PDF 举报
"Oracle DBA手记3:数据库性能优化与内部原理解析" 本书是一部由多位Oracle数据库技术专家合作编写的DBA指南,主要聚焦于数据库性能优化与Oracle的内部原理解析。书中涵盖了作者们在实际工作中的经验分享,旨在帮助读者深入理解和应用Oracle技术。以下是对各章节主要内容的概述: 1. 《DBA 之路》部分,作者冯春培分享了他的人生感悟和数据库领域的专业经验,包括主机性能评估、数据库水平拆分、数据同步等项目,强调了DBA在大规模数据处理和风险控制中的重要角色。 2. 《DBA 手记》章节,杨廷琨探讨了数据库性能问题,如TRUNCATE语句优化、物化视图的查询重写、PL/SQL过程监控等,并提供了数据泵的实用案例。姜龙分享了同义词、逻辑读优化、物化视图的应用和TimesTen内存数据库在性能提升中的作用。 3. 《面向程序员的数据库访问性能优化法则》由叶正盛撰写,讲解了数据库访问的基本概念和优化法则,适合程序员了解如何高效地与数据库交互。 4. 《Linux 大内存页Oracle 数据库优化》中,熊军讨论了利用Linux大内存页进行数据库性能提升的方法,解释了CPU使用分析和问题解决方案。 5. 《SQL 与SQL 优化》部分,崔华详细解读了SQL执行计划,包括执行顺序、绑定变量影响、10053事件分析以及性能问题案例。此外,他还介绍了SQL Profile的使用,以稳定和改变SQL执行计划。 6. 《Oracle 中的NULL 值解析》章节,作者揭示了NULL值的基础、布尔运算、默认数据类型,以及它与索引和数据恢复的关系。 7. 《内部原理与优化》涵盖了Oracle的索引分裂、TX锁等待、Latch原理、逻辑读写等内部机制,帮助读者理解Oracle数据库的底层运作。 本书内容丰富,深入浅出,是Oracle DBA和开发者的重要参考资料,有助于提升数据库管理和优化技能。通过学习,读者可以更好地应对数据库性能挑战,实现更高效的数据库操作。